OMS Energy Technologies Inc.
ENERGY · OIL & GAS EQUIPMENT & SERVICES · USA
OMS Energy Technologies Inc., manufacturing and sale of specialty connectors and pipes, surface wellhead and Christmas tree, premium threading services, and other ancillary services. The company is headquartered in Singapore.
